In the USA and around the globe, democracy is underneath menace. Anti-democratic attitudes have grow to be extra prevalent, partisan polarization is rising, misinformation is omnipresent, and politicians and residents generally query the integrity of elections. 

With this backdrop, the MIT Division of Political Science is launching an effort to determine a Strengthening Democracy Initiative. On this Q&A, division head David Singer, the Raphael Dorman-Helen Starbuck Professor of Political Science, discusses the objectives and scope of the initiative.

Q: What’s the objective of the Strengthening Democracy Initiative?

A: Nicely-functioning democracies require accountable representatives, correct and freely accessible info, equitable citizen voice and participation, free and honest elections, and an abiding respect for democratic establishments. It’s unsettling for the political science neighborhood to see an increasing number of proof of democratic backsliding in Europe, Latin America, and even right here within the U.S. Whereas we can’t single-handedly cease the erosion of democratic norms and practices, we will focus our energies on understanding and explaining the basis causes of the issue, and devising interventions to keep up the wholesome functioning of democracies.

MIT political science has a historical past of producing vital analysis on many aspects of the democratic course of, together with voting conduct, election administration, info and misinformation, public opinion and political responsiveness, and lobbying. The objectives of the Strengthening Democracy Initiative are to put these varied analysis packages underneath one umbrella, to foster synergies amongst our varied analysis initiatives and between political science and different disciplines, and to mark MIT because the nation’s main middle for rigorous, evidence-based evaluation of democratic resiliency.

Q: What’s the initiative’s analysis focus?

A: The initiative is constructed upon three analysis pillars. One pillar is election science and administration. Democracy can’t perform with out well-run elections and, simply as vital, in style belief in these elections. Even inside the U.S., not to mention different international locations, there’s super variation within the electoral course of: whether or not and the way individuals register to vote, whether or not they vote in individual or by mail, how polling locations are run, how votes are counted and validated, and the way the outcomes are communicated to residents.

The MIT Election Knowledge and Science Lab is already the nation’s main middle for the gathering and evaluation of election-related information and dissemination of electoral greatest practices, and it’s effectively positioned to extend the dimensions and scope of its actions.

The second pillar is public opinion, a wealthy space of research that features experimental research of public responses to misinformation and analyses of presidency responsiveness to mass attitudes. Our school make use of survey and experimental strategies to review a spread of substantive areas, together with taxation and well being coverage, state and native politics, and techniques for countering political rumors within the U.S. and overseas. College analysis packages kind the idea for this pillar, together with longstanding collaborations such because the Political Experiments Analysis Lab, an annual omnibus survey through which college students and school can take part, and frequent conferences and seminars.

The third pillar is political participation, which incorporates the impression of the prison justice system and different destructive interactions with the state on voting, the creation of citizen assemblies, and the lobbying conduct of companies on Congressional laws. A few of this analysis depends on machine studying and AI to cull and parse an unlimited quantity of information, giving researchers visibility into phenomena that have been beforehand troublesome to research. A associated analysis space on political deliberation brings collectively laptop science, AI, and the social sciences to research the dynamics of political discourse in on-line boards and the doable interventions that may attenuate political polarization and foster consensus.

The initiative’s versatile design will permit for brand new pillars to be added over time, together with worldwide and homeland safety, strengthening democracies in several areas of the world, and tackling new challenges to democratic processes that we can’t see but.

Q: Why is MIT well-suited to host this new initiative?

A: Many individuals view MIT as a STEM-focused, extremely technical place. And certainly it’s, however there’s a super quantity of collaboration throughout and inside colleges at MIT — for instance, between political science and the Schwarzman School of Computing and the Sloan College of Administration, and between the social science fields and the colleges of science and engineering. The Strengthening Democracy Initiative will profit from these collaborations and create new bridges between political science and different fields. It’s additionally vital to notice that this can be a nonpartisan analysis endeavor. The MIT political science division has a repute for rigorous, data-driven approaches to the research of politics, and its place inside the MIT ecosystem will assist us to keep up a repute as an “trustworthy dealer,” and to disseminate path-breaking, evidence-based analysis and interventions to assist democracies grow to be extra resilient.

Q: Will the brand new initiative have an academic mission?

A: In fact! The division has a protracted historical past of bringing in scores of undergraduate researchers through MIT’s Undergraduate Analysis Alternatives Program. The initiative shall be structured to offer these college students with alternatives to review varied aspects of the democratic course of, and for school to have a prepared pool of gifted college students to help with their initiatives. My hope is to offer college students with the assets and alternatives to check their very own theories by designing and implementing surveys within the U.S. and overseas, and use insights and instruments from laptop science, utilized statistics, and different disciplines to review political phenomena. Because the initiative grows, I anticipate extra alternatives for college kids to collaborate with state and native officers on enhancements to election administration, and to review new puzzles associated to wholesome democracies.

Postdoctoral researchers can even play a outstanding function by advancing analysis throughout the initiative’s pillars, supervising undergraduate researchers, and dealing with a few of the administrative points of the work.

Q: This feels like a long-term endeavor. Do you anticipate this initiative to be everlasting?

A: Sure. We have already got the items in place to create a number one middle for the research of wholesome democracies (and find out how to make them more healthy). However we have to construct capability, together with assets for a pool of researchers to shift from one challenge to a different, which can allow synergies between initiatives and foster new ones. A everlasting initiative can even present the infrastructure for school and college students to reply swiftly to present occasions and new analysis findings — for instance, by launching a nationwide survey experiment, or amassing new information on a side of the electoral course of, or testing the impression of a brand new AI know-how on political perceptions. As I like to inform our supporters, there are new challenges to wholesome democracies that weren’t on our radar 10 years in the past, and little doubt there shall be others 10 years from now that we now have not imagined. We must be ready to do the rigorous evaluation on no matter challenges come our means. And MIT Political Science is the very best place on the planet to undertake this bold agenda in the long run.
